Here is a sum up of Standard, Premium and Business SLA.
You have 100Mbps/client. This means that the customer has 100Mbps for all servers at Ovh. With Kimsufi, he can not exceed 100Mbps/client. With PRO offers, if he uses <20Mbps / server, it may exceed 100Mbps/client. All this without paying more. Everything is included in the price of servers. To overcome > 100Mbps/client and> 20Mbps/serveur, it can also buy more bandwidth. In any case, we do not limit the Ovh internal traffic (between Ovh Ips)
The details:
- Without any additional fees (all included in the server price):
-------------------------------------------------- -----
- The Kimsufi, by default, "SLA Standard Burstable": 100 Mbps guaranteed in a non-permanent way, aka bandwidth burstable temporarily to 100Mbps. (temporarily means "less than 24 hours").
- If the customer uses bandwidth intensively and / or permanently, it is switched to "SLA Standard noBurstable" guarantee 10Mbps, not burstable.
Note:
Generally speaking, we do not want to give more guarantees for Kimsufi offers. Either the customer is an individual and does not need these guarantees or he is a PRO and he has to switch to PRO offers that have all necessary guarantees.
- PRO, default is "SLA Premium": the guaranteed bandwidth of 100Mbps, not burstable.
- If the customer uses > 100Mbps/client and is doing > 20Mbps/serveur, the server which is > 20Mbps will switch to SLA Premium Burstable: bandwidth guarantee of 20Mbps, 500Mbps burstable / server, the burst evolves between 500Mbps and 0Mbps according to peak time and rush hours and depends on the destination.
- With additional options that the customer can pay for (PRO only):
-------------------------------------------------- --------------------
If the customer wants > 100Mbps/client AND > 20Mbps/serveur, he may purchase option SLA Business. It may go to 1Gbps/client.
For servers with 100Mbps connection:
- SLA Business, 100Mbps guarantee, 500Mbps burstable / server at £149/month
For servers with 1Gbps connection:
- SLA Business, 100Mbps guarantee, 500Mbps burstable / server at £149/month
- SLA Business, guarantee 200Mbps, 500Mbps burstable / server at £299/month
- SLA Business, guarantee 300Mbps, 500Mbps burstable / server at £349/month
If the customer uses the burst intensively and / or permanently (temporarily means "less than 36 hours"). it is switched to
- SLA Business noBurstable guaranteed 100Mbps not burstable / server
- SLA Business noBurstable guaranteed 200Mbps not burstable / server
- SLA Business noBurstable guaranteed 300Mbps not burstable / server
We can summarize all this by:
- The Kimsufi are suitable for non-business use
- The PRO is suitable for professional use with the guarantees necessary
- With SLA Business, the customer can buy the bandwidth to go up to 1Gbps.
